Estate Litigation and Wills Variation Actions
Trustees and executors of wills retain GSW to resist claims
by disappointed beneficiaries. We also assist claimants who have been
disinherited.
Examples of our work in this area include:
- pursuing the redistribution of gifts made pursuant to
the deceased's will
- advancing claims under the equitable relief jurisdiction
of the court where the deceased has not left a will
- negotiating and crafting resolutions to solve the problems
created by unequal gifting amongst family members
- appointing a committee where the individual is incompetent
by reason of mental or physical infirmity
- bringing proceedings to interpret a trust agreement
or a will
- seeking a determination of the capacity of the testator
to make a will
